The Future of Fees and Crypto Futures

The competitive landscape of crypto futures exchanges is driving a trend towards lower fees. We expect to see continued innovation in fee structures, with more exchanges offering negative maker fees and tiered VIP programs. The rise of decentralized exchanges (DEXs) also presents a potential alternative, with different fee models based on gas costs and liquidity pools. However, DEXs currently often suffer from lower liquidity and higher slippage. Fee Component !! Impact on Profitability !! Optimization Strategy
Maker Fees || Low Impact (when using limit orders) || Increase trading volume to qualify for lower rates; hold platform tokens.
Taker Fees || High Impact (especially for frequent trading) || Utilize limit orders; increase trading volume; hold platform tokens.
Funding Rates || Significant Impact (for perpetual futures) || Monitor funding rate trends; hedge positions; arbitrage between exchanges.
Withdrawal Fees || Moderate Impact (for infrequent withdrawals) || Consolidate funds; choose exchanges with lower withdrawal fees.
